WebTree support is much, much harder to compute than ordinary support. Especially if you have really high models or high branch diameter angle and high branch diameter resolution. The most significant reason for this is that it needs to compute a collision volume for each possible diameter of the branches.

WebOct 20, 2024 · The first thing to do upon opening Cura is to go to “Print Settings,” click “Custom,” select “Configure Setting Visibility,” and “Check All.” This will give you access to settings that would otherwise have been hidden. To start creating supports, just scroll down to Support Settings and click “Generate Support.” WebNov 8, 2024 · With alternate skin rotation, the direction of the top and bottom layers will swap between the two diagonal directions, and print in the X or Y direction only. This helps close the top layer better and decreases the chance of pillowing. This setting only works with lines and a zig-zag bottom/top pattern. Alternate skin rotation visualized.

WebApr 24, 2024 · Tree supports is one type of support offered by the Ultimaker Cura slicer software. As the name implies, the major characteristic of tree supports is that they look like branches of trees. This is more than just aesthetics, though – the unique shape of tree supports offers some unique benefits.
